The aim of this study was to compare robotic arm-assisted bi-unicompartmental knee arthroplasty (bi-UKA) with conventional mechanically aligned total knee arthroplasty (TKA) in order to determine the changes in the anatomy of the knee and alignment of the lower limb following surgery.
An analysis of 38 patients who underwent TKA and 32 who underwent bi-UKA was performed as a secondary study from a prospective, single-centre, randomized controlled trial. CT imaging was used to measure coronal, sagittal, and axial alignment of the knee preoperatively and at three months postoperatively to determine changes in anatomy that had occurred as a result of the surgery. The hip-knee-ankle angle (HKAA) was also measured to identify any differences between the two groups.
The pre- to postoperative changes in joint anatomy were significantly less in patients undergoing bi-UKA in all three planes in both the femur and tibia, except for femoral sagittal component orientation in which there was no difference. Overall, , cruciate-sparing bi-UKA maintains the natural anatomy of the knee in the coronal, sagittal, and axial planes better, and may therefore preserve normal joint kinematics, compared with a mechanically aligned TKA. This includes preservation of coronal joint line obliquity. HKAA alignment was corrected towards neutral significantly less in patients undergoing bi-UKA, which may represent restoration of the pre-disease constitutional alignment (p less then 0.001). The aims of this study were to investigate the mortality following a proximal humeral fracture. Data from a large population-based fracture register were used to quantify 30-day, 90-day, and one-year mortality rates after a proximal humeral fracture. Associations between the risk of mortality and the type of fracture and its treatment were assessed, and mortality rates were compared between patients who sustained a fracture and the general population.
All patients with a proximal humeral fracture recorded in the Swedish Fracture Register between 2011 and 2017 were included in the study. Those who died during follow-up were identified via linkage with the Swedish Tax Agency population register. Age- and sex-adjusted controls were retrieved from Statistics Sweden and standardized mortality ratios (SMRs) were calculated.
A total of 18,452 patients who sustained a proximal humeral fracture were included. Their mean age was 68.8 years (16 to 107) and the majority (13,729; 74.4%) were women. The aim of this longitudinal study was to clarify whether significant alterations in structural connectivity occur over time in patients with newly diagnosed focal epilepsy of unknown origin.
A total of 40 patients with newly diagnosed focal epilepsy of unknown origin and with normal brain magnetic resonance imaging (MRI) on visual inspection were enrolled. All subjects underwent MRI twice involving three-dimensional volumetric T1-weighted imaging, which were suitable for structural volume analysis. Gray matter volumes were obtained using the FreeSurfer image analysis suite, and structural connectivity analyses were performed using Matlab-based BRain Analysis using graPH theory software.
The median interval between the two MRI scans was 18.5 months in patients with epilepsy. There was a general tendency toward decreased gray matter volumes on the second scan compared with the initial scan. However, the volumes of the right and left thalamus and brainstem on the second MRI scan had an increased tendency compared with those on the initial MRI scan. In measures of connectivity, there were significant differences between the two MRI scans. The mean clustering coefficient, global efficiency, local efficiency, and the small-worldness index were significantly increased, whereas the characteristic path length was decreased on the second MRI scan compared with the initial MRI scan.
The structural connectivity in patients with newly diagnosed focal epilepsy of unknown origin increases over time in the initial stage. These alterations and increases in structural connectivity may be related to underlying epileptogenicity in the initial stages of epilepsy.

Previous studies have suggested that diabetes mellitus (DM) could be a protective factor against amyotrophic lateral sclerosis (ALS) although the results are inconsistent. This study aimed to comprehensively investigate this relationship by identifying all available studies and summarizing their results.
A systematic review was conducted in MEDLINE and EMBASE database from inception to January 1st, 2020 to identify cohort studies and case-control studies that investigated the risk of development of ALS among patients with DM versus individuals without DM. Point estimates and standard errors from eligible studies were pooled together using the generic inverse variance method, as described by DerSimonian and Laird. Visualization of the funnel plot was used to assess for the presence of publication bias.
A total of 1683 articles were identified by the search strategy. After two rounds of review, three cohort studies and eight case-control studies fulfilled the inclusion criteria and were included in the meta-analysis. The risk of developing ALS was significantly lower among patients with DM than individuals without DM with the pooled relative risk of 0.68 (95 % CI, 0.55 - 0.84; I
81 %). The funnel plot was relatively symmetric and was not suggestive of the presence of publication bias.
A significantly decreased risk of ALS among patients with DM was observed in this meta-analysis.

Despite its rich vasculature, the thyroid gland is a rare site of metastatic disease. We present a systematic review of colorectal cancer (CRC) thyroid metastases, with emphasis on diagnosis, therapeutic management, and oncological outcomes.
A systematic review of the English literature (1990 to 2019) was performed, using the PubMed, Embase, and Google Scholar bibliographic databases. https://www.selleckchem.com/products/upf-1069.html For each patient, epidemiological, surgical, histopathological, and oncological data were extracted.
A total of 111 patients (40% males, mean age 61 ± 12years) were included in the final analysis. The primary CRC was locally advanced (T3-T4) in 83%, had positive lymph nodes (N+) in 65%, and had distant metastases (M+) in 28%. Thyroid metastases were synchronous in 15% and metachronous in 80%, with a mean interval of 51 ± 31months from primary tumor treatment. Thyroid metastatic disease was diagnosed clinically (60%), radiologically (33%), biochemically (2%), or postmortem (5%). When performed, FNA biopsy was diagnostic in 73% and highly suspicious in 13%. A total of 63% of patients had additional distant metastases, usually in the liver or lungs, while 68% of patients underwent surgical excision (total or subtotal thyroidectomy 58%, lobectomy 42%) and 43% received adjuvant chemotherapy or radiotherapy. Mean overall survival after primary CRC was 55.5 ± 34.7months, with mean disease-free survival of 31.3 ± 27.2months. Following diagnosis or treatment of thyroid metastases, 1-, 2- and 3-year survival rates were 79, 66, and 60%, respectively. Mean survival following diagnosis of thyroid metastases was 11.3months.
CRC thyroid metastasis is a relatively uncommon event, usually associated with locoregionally advanced tumors. Prognosis is poor, mainly due to multimetastatic disease.

Atopic dermatitis (AD) is a common inflammatory skin disease in children and adults. Little is known regarding the association of childhood AD with cognitive dysfunction.
To evaluate the association of AD and cognitive dysfunction, including memory impairment, developmental delays and attentiondeficit (hyperactivity) disorderin US children (age <18 years).
Data was analyzed from the National Health Interview Survey 2008 to 2018, which used a multistage, clustered, cross-sectional design.
The prevalences of cognitive dysfunction, such as memory impairment (0.87% vs 0.42%), developmental delays (6.96% vs 3.87%), and attention deficit (hyperactivity) disorder (10.78% vs 8.10%), were higher in children with vs without AD. In multivariable logistic regression models adjusting for age, sex, race, region, socioeconomic factors, allergic conditions, and mental health, childhood AD was associated with higher odds of memory impairment (adjusted odds ratio [95% confidence interval] 1.84 [1.34-2.51]), developmental delays (1.54 [1.40-1.70]), and attention deficit (hyperactivity) disorder (1.31 [1.20-1.42]) compared with children without AD. Childhood atopic disease (defined as comorbid AD, asthma, allergic rhinitis, and food allergies) further increased the prevalence of developmental delays to 13.44% (2.10 [1.20-3.70]) in boys but not in girls.
In a nationally representative sample of the US population, a statistically significant and positive association between childhood AD and atopic disease with cognitive dysfunction was identified (P < .001). Furthermore, a dimorphic relationship with developmental delays was identified between sexes.

Resin acids in pulp and paper mills wastewater are potentially partitioned in the solids in post-primary clarification due to higher hydrophobicity with log Kow ∼1.74-5.80. They are known to adversely affect anaerobic digestion (AD) process, although the effect has not been quantified deterministically in control studies. The objective of the present work was to determine the effect of untreated and ozonated spiked resin acids on AD of primary sludge. Batch adsorption tests were conducted to determine the solid-liquid partition coefficient (Kd) of resin acids on the primary sludge. Higher Kd was obtained at pH 4; however, it was decreased by 78-98% at pH 8. Thereafter, batch AD of model resin acids in primary sludge using food to microorganism ratio (S0/X) of 0.5gtCOD/gVSSindicated only 15-20% removal of resin acids in the liquid phase anaerobically. While, ozonation in pure water using 0.74-1.48 mg O3/mg tCOD showed >90% reduction of the test resin acids, an ozone dose of 0.52 mg O3/mg tCOD reduced 50-70% spiked resin acids' load to the digester. However, no further removal of resin acids occurred during AD over 30 days. About 42% reduction in methane production compared to the control digestor occurred in the presence of 150 mg/L of resin acids.
